编程小游戏制作中的优化技巧

在当今科技飞速发展的时代,编程小游戏制作已成为众多开发者追求的热点。一款优秀的编程小游戏不仅能够吸引玩家,还能在游戏中锻炼编程技能。然而,如何优化编程小游戏制作过程,提高游戏质量,成为了开发者们关注的焦点。本文将为您介绍一些编程小游戏制作中的优化技巧,帮助您打造一款更出色的作品。

一、游戏设计阶段

  1. 明确游戏目标:在游戏设计阶段,首先要明确游戏的目标,包括游戏类型、玩法、故事背景等。明确的目标有助于后续开发过程中保持方向。

  2. 精简游戏内容:避免游戏内容过于复杂,导致玩家难以理解。精简游戏内容,突出核心玩法,提高游戏的可玩性。

  3. 合理布局关卡:设计关卡时,要考虑玩家的操作习惯,合理布局关卡难度。从简单到复杂,逐步提升玩家的挑战感。

二、编程实现阶段

  1. 选择合适的编程语言:根据游戏需求,选择适合的编程语言。例如,C++适合性能要求较高的游戏,Python适合快速开发。

  2. 模块化设计:将游戏功能划分为多个模块,便于管理和维护。模块化设计有助于提高代码复用率,降低开发成本。

  3. 优化算法:针对游戏中的关键算法进行优化,提高游戏运行效率。例如,使用空间换时间的方法,减少计算量。

三、图形与音效优化

  1. 合理使用贴图资源:合理使用贴图资源,避免重复使用。使用高质量贴图,提升游戏画面效果。

  2. 优化音效处理:音效处理要注重音质和节奏,与游戏画面和剧情相匹配。适当使用音效,增强游戏氛围。

案例分析

以某编程小游戏为例,该游戏在开发过程中采用了以下优化技巧:

  1. 明确游戏目标:游戏以锻炼编程思维为核心,采用关卡挑战形式,让玩家在游戏中学习编程知识。

  2. 模块化设计:游戏功能划分为多个模块,如关卡设计、角色控制、音效管理等,便于后续维护和升级。

  3. 优化算法:针对游戏中的算法进行优化,如地图生成算法、角色移动算法等,提高游戏运行效率。

通过以上优化技巧,该编程小游戏在短时间内获得了较高的口碑和用户量。

总之,在编程小游戏制作过程中,优化技巧至关重要。开发者们应根据游戏需求,灵活运用各种优化方法,打造出更优质的作品。

猜你喜欢:语聊交友开发